Collectible coins encompass a wide range of types, including historical coins, commemorative issues, and various denominations. In the United States, notable examples include the Cent, which has undergone various design changes since its inception. The Massachusetts Copper is a significant early American coin, minted in the late 18th century, reflecting the region's contribution to colonial coinage and its role in early American currency. Collectors often seek these coins for their historical significance, rarity, and unique designs.
